Manantial Group's story

The Manantial communal bank is made up of hardworking and caring women, who support each other in order to get ahead and improve the quality of life of their families.

They are currently taking part in training programmes which will strengthen their businesses and promote the advancement of each member.

Marlene is one of the women and is the managing director of the group. She makes a living from decorating events. 

She will use the loan to buy decorating supplies and tools such as fabric, paint, boards, polystyrene foam and glue. This will allow Marlene to increase production, to better meet customer demand and to continue expanding her business.
